Problem
The existing cleaning tools with zigzag transverse ends result in fibers of varying lengths, leading to poor cleaning effectiveness, particularly in areas with shorter fiber lengths.
Innovation Solution
A cleaning tool with a cleaning sheet and holder, featuring a brush part composed of fibers of uniform length, including a first and second brush region where the second region is longer and protrudes, enhancing cleaning efficacy by ensuring consistent fiber length and orientation across the tool.

To provide a cleaning tool exhibiting excellent cleaning effectiveness. [Solution] The present invention relates to a cleaning tool (A) comprising a cleaning sheet (100), and a holding tool (200) for holding said cleaning sheet (100). The cleaning sheet (100) is provided with: a brush part (110) capable of cleaning an object to be cleaned; a base part (120); and insertion parts (130) for the holding tool (200). The brush part (110) is configured from a fibre assembly (100GF), and is provided with first brush regions (111) and second brush regions (112). The second brush regions (112) are provided with protruded regions (112L) configured so as to be longer than the first brush regions (111).
